Bronzeville: A Vibrant Neighborhood in Chicago, Illinois
Located in Cook County, Illinois, Bronzeville is a dynamic neighborhood nestled within the bustling city of Chicago. Known for its rich history and vibrant culture, Bronzeville offers residents a unique blend of charm, diversity, and convenience.
One of the distinctive features of Bronzeville is its collection of high-rise buildings, with many homes boasting seven or more stories. This architectural style adds a touch of sophistication and elegance to the neighborhood's skyline. These high-rise homes provide residents with stunning views of the cityscape and Lake Michigan, creating a truly remarkable living experience.
Living in a high-rise home in Bronzeville offers numerous advantages. Residents can enjoy the convenience of having amenities such as fitness centers, rooftop terraces, and concierge services right at their fingertips. Additionally, the close proximity to downtown Chicago ensures easy access to a wide array of shopping, dining, and entertainment options.
Bronzeville itself is a vibrant community with a rich cultural heritage. It is renowned for its significant contributions to African American history, arts, and literature. The neighborhood is home to various landmarks, museums, and art galleries that showcase this proud heritage.
Residents of Bronzeville also benefit from its excellent transportation infrastructure. With easy access to major highways and public transportation, commuting to other parts of the city is a breeze.
